Remarks

The admission process is conducted by the IPC cap round. The exam syllabus is according to IPC but conducted by college as per the given time interval.

Course Curriculum Overview

3.5

The faculty is very educated some of M. Pharm and some of them completed their Ph.D. It includes 4Setional 2semester in a year. The capacity of students is approx 120 in a batch.

Placement Experience

2.5

Students are eligible for campus placement in the final year (7th semester). Many local and national companies visited.

Fees and Financial Aid

Fees may differ per year. But the tuition fee, it includes Library cards (to issue any book). General students can apply for EBC (if they fit in that criteria). There is also a scholarship scheme for other cast students.

Campus Life

4

Annual fest can be conducted in the last week of January or the first week of February. Conducted by 3rd-year students by contributing all 4-year students but it costs some money. The college has very big library and it's great to point to. An annual fest week college includes sports and extracurricular activities on campus, the college also participate in a competition or any programs which are conducted by the university. College also has an anti-ragging committee.
